14 | ## Unit
|
15 |
|
16 | Stores values for a scalar unit and its postfix. (eg `100 mm` or `100 kg`). Although the `Unit` class contains public functions documented as follows, using the following API directly is *not* recommended. Prefer using the functions in the "math" namespace wherever possible.

37 | ## Matrix
|
38 |
|
39 | Two types of matrix classes are available in math.js, for storage of dense and sparse matrices. Although they contain public functions documented as follows, using the following API directly is *not* recommended. Prefer using the functions in the "math" namespace wherever possible.
